[1] : The Collaborative International Dictionary of English v.0.48
ycleped \ycleped"\, p. p. as. geclipod, p. p. of clipian,
   cleopian, cliopian, to call. see clepe, and also the note
   under y-.
   called; named; -- obsolete, except in archaic or humorous
   writings. spelt also yclept.
   1913 webster

         it is full fair to ben yclept madame.    --chaucer.
   1913 webster

         but come, thou goddess fair and free.
         in heaven ycleped euphrosyne.            --milton.
   1913 webster

         those charming little missives ycleped valentines.
                                                  --lamb.
   1913 webster

[2] : The Collaborative International Dictionary of English v.0.48
clepe \clepe\, v. t. imp.  p. p. clepedor; p. pr.  vb. n.
   cleping. cf. ycleped. as. clepan, cleopian, clipian,
   clypian, to cry, call.
   to call, or name. obs.
   1913 webster

         that other son was cleped cambalo.       --chaucer.
   1913 webster
